


Detailed process of sending emails using PHP using SMTP protocol and PEAR library
With the continuous development and popularization of the Internet, email, as an important way of transmitting information, has gradually become an indispensable part of our lives and work. For web application developers, sending emails is also a very common need. PHP is a commonly used server-side programming language that provides a series of email sending functions and extensions, but in certain scenarios, using the SMTP protocol and the PEAR library to send emails may be a better choice. This article will introduce in detail the specific process of sending emails using PHP using the SMTP protocol and the PEAR library.
1. What is SMTP protocol and PEAR library
SMTP (Simple Mail Transfer Protocol) is a member of the TCP/IP protocol family and is used to transmit mail on the network. . PEAR (PHP Extension and Application Repository) is a collection of PHP extensions and application libraries, which contains many commonly used PHP libraries and components, such as email sending components, database components, etc.
2. Prerequisites for using the SMTP protocol to send emails
To use the SMTP protocol to send emails, we need to prepare the following prerequisites:
- SMTP server address and port
You need to use an SMTP server to send emails. The server address and port can be provided by the email provider, or you can build it yourself. SMTP servers usually require authentication before sending emails. Authentication information includes username and password.
- SMTP extension for PHP
PHP provides an SMTP extension through which we can send emails using the SMTP protocol. Before using the SMTP extension, we need to confirm whether the extension has been enabled in php.ini. You can use the phpinfo() function to check whether php.ini contains "SMTP" related configuration items.
- Email content
The email content includes the email subject, recipient address, sender address, sender name, email content, etc. These contents will be SMTP server sends out.
3. Prerequisites for using the PEAR library to send emails
To use the PEAR library to send emails, we need to prepare the following prerequisites:
- PEAR library Installation
The PEAR library can be installed through the PEAR command line tool. For specific methods, please view the PEAR official documentation. During the installation process, you may encounter permissions and other issues that require attention.
- Email content
The preparation of the email content is the same as the content of the email sent by SMTP protocol.
3. The specific process of sending emails using SMTP protocol and PEAR library
The following is the specific process of sending emails using SMTP protocol and PEAR library:
- Using SMTP Sending emails via protocol
(1) Connect to SMTP server:
Use PHP's fsockopen() function to connect to the SMTP server. This function requires the address and port of the SMTP server to be passed in. After the connection is successful, send an EHLO or HELO command to tell the SMTP server your name.
(2) Authentication SMTP server:
After connecting to the SMTP server, authentication is required. The authentication information includes user name and password. You can use commands such as AUTH LOGIN or AUTH PLAIN for authentication.
(3) Set email header information:
Use PHP's header() function to set email header information, including email subject, sender address, recipient address, etc.
(4) Set the email content:
Use PHP's fwrite() function to write the email content to the connection handle. The email content includes the email header information and the email body.
(5) Close the connection:
Use PHP’s fclose() function to close the connection.
- Use the PEAR library to send emails
(1)Introduce the PEAR library:
Use the require_once statement to introduce the Mail.php and Mail/mime.php files , these two files are the core files used to send emails in the PEAR library.
(2) Set email header information:
Use the setHeaders() method of the Mail_mime class to set email header information, including email subject, sender address, recipient address, etc.
(3) Set the email content:
Use the setHTMLBody() method or setTxtBody() method of the Mail_mime class to set the email body content.
(4) Create a mail instance and send it:
Use the factory() method of the Mail class to create a mail instance, and then use the send() method of the instance to send the mail.
4. Precautions
In the process of sending emails using the SMTP protocol and the PEAR library, you need to pay attention to the following points:
- Security issues
The SMTP server requires username and password authentication, so it is necessary to ensure the security of the authentication information, such as using the HTTPS protocol for transmission.
- Encoding problem
The encoding of the email content needs to be consistent with the mail server, otherwise garbled characters may occur. It is recommended to use UTF-8 encoding format.
- Email sending frequency
The email sending frequency needs to be adjusted according to the limits of the SMTP server. If the limit is exceeded, the sending may fail or be prohibited by the server.
In short, when using the SMTP protocol and the PEAR library to send emails, it needs to be adjusted and optimized according to the actual situation to ensure the stability and security of email sending.
